A Summary of Metal Finishing - Nearly always, metal polishing is needed for a pleasing appearance as well as clean-room situations. It really is among the most preferred practices due to its utility in improving upon the natural attractiveness of the items, for instance, motorbike parts, kitchenware or motor vehicle parts. Equally, a lot of clean-rooms desire a burnished finish so as to lower the penetrability of the material which might cause dirt to build up and contaminate. A good demonstration of this practice could be in a vacuum chamber.

There are actually a great number of approaches to finish metal, and we'll think about several of the methods required. Various metals can be burnished using chemicals, electromechanically, using purpose built buffing machines, or by hand. A buffing compound or paste can be utilised, which may incorporate lim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Finishing stainless steel, due to its substandard th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its somewhat high viscidness is considered the most time intensive. More over, things composed of non-ferrous metals are much more receptive to polishing, as these need the least amount of processes.

Finishing buffs smothered with paste will be enormously affected by specific force on the surface of the polishing pad. The concentration of the surface pressure could be amplified within certain levels, having said that, employing above the optimum amount of force not merely minimizes the quality level of the process, but additionally reduces the level of efficiency, could cause wear on the component, and there is in addition an apparent overheating of the metal being worked on, due to friction. When you are working on thin metal, it will be higher temperature (and the resulting flexibility of the material) that may cause parts to distort, buckle or warp. Commonly, it will take an educated technician to look at every one of these points to equally not cause damage to the workpiece and to perform effectively. For you to significantly boost the quality of the resulting finish, the finishing operation really should be completed with a lesser amount of aggression and not a large amount of force in order to finally produce a surface area that doesn't have any scratches or marks which result from the polishing procedure, thus ending up with a lovely mirror finish.
